On Fri, 22 Sep 2017 20:29:07 +0200, Werner Koch wrote: > You may use the latest Enigmail or Kmail to automate the upload but > you can also use Posteo's Web interface to upload the key. But take > care: Posteo does not allow a Name in the user id, only the mail > address (addr-spec) is allowed. Thus you need to add a second user > id with just your mailaddress and use gpg's filter stuff to export > only that UID. GnuPG 2.2.1 automates that tasks and creates another > user if needed.

Then i checked posteo's FAQ and now i see (under Point 4.) this: Diese Kriterien muss Ihr öffentlicher OpenPGP-Schlüssel erfüllen, um ihn bei Posteo hinterlegen zu können. 1. Das Namensfeld muss leer sein oder lediglich Ihre E-Mail-Adresse enthalten. 2. Der öffentliche Schlüssel darf nur eine E-Mail-Adresse enthalten. Unterschlüssel (Subkeys) oder mehrere E-Mail-Adressen sind nicht zulässig. 3. Ihr Schlüssel muss Ihre Posteo-E-Mail-Adresse oder eine Ihrer Alias-Adressen enthalten. 4. Der Schlüssel darf nicht von anderen unterschrieben oder signiert sein. 5. Der Schlüssel darf kein Foto oder andere persönliche Daten enthalten.
